Analysis

In 2023, maize (corn) — crop residues (direct emissions n2o), annual growth in Belize stood at 4.14 % change on previous year.

The figure is up 195.9% on the previous year and down 70.3% over ten years.

Over the whole period, maize (corn) — crop residues (direct emissions n2o), annual growth in Belize peaked at 78.57 % change on previous year in 1970 and was at its lowest, -33.33 % change on previous year, in 1962.

Belize ranks 69th of 174 countries on this measure, in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.
